FAQ Hero
DNS

¿Cómo funciona la búsqueda de DNS?

¿Qué es DNS?

DNS son las siglas de «Domain Name System» (sistema de nombres de dominio). Este sistema utiliza servidores de nombres autoritativos designados para asignar nombres de dominio a direcciones IP numéricas.

¿Qué es una búsqueda de DNS?

Una búsqueda de DNS, o búsqueda de registros de DNS, es el proceso mediante el cual los nombres de dominio legibles por humanos (por ejemplo, www.digicert.com) se convierten en una dirección IP legible por el ordenador (por ejemplo, 216.168.246.55).

Una búsqueda de DNS es el proceso de consulta que se inicia cada vez que se introduce una URL en la barra de direcciones del navegador web. El solucionador recursivo de DNS —también conocido como «recursor» o «solucionador» a secas— comprobará primero si la información solicitada está en la caché. Si la información no está disponible en la caché, el solucionador solicitará la dirección IP a los servidores de nombres raíz, TLD y autoritativos.

Una vez encontrada la dirección IP, el solucionador devolverá esa información al cliente (el ordenador del usuario) en forma de la página web a la que se desea acceder.

¿Qué es un proceso de consulta?

El proceso de consulta incluye todos los pasos necesarios para convertir el nombre de dominio al que se desea acceder en una dirección IP. El proceso comienza cuando el usuario introduce una dirección web en el navegador. El servidor recursivo es la primera parada de la consulta. A partir de ahí, el recursor se pone en contacto con una serie de servidores de nombres autoritativos para obtener la información que necesita a fin de convertir el nombre de dominio en un lenguaje inteligible para el ordenador. Por último, se devuelve la dirección IP del dominio deseado.

Los registros DNS fijan las reglas y establecen las rutas por las que viajará la consulta. Almacenan toda la información relevante que los servidores necesitan para convertir correctamente las direcciones de correo electrónico y los nombres de dominio en direcciones numéricas significativas para completar el proceso de DNS.

¿Qué es una búsqueda de DNS directa?

La búsqueda de DNS directa (Forward DNS Lookup) es uno de los dos tipos de búsqueda de DNS. Este tipo sigue el proceso estándar de consulta de DNS cuando se introduce una URL o se envía un correo electrónico y se recibe la dirección IP relacionada en respuesta a la solicitud.

Este proceso permite al cliente final (el dispositivo del usuario) convertir un nombre de dominio o una dirección de correo electrónico en la dirección del dispositivo responsable de la transferencia de datos del lado del servidor.

¿Qué es una búsqueda de DNS inversa?

La búsqueda de DNS inversa (Reverse DNS Lookup) es el segundo tipo de búsqueda de DNS. Esta solicitud de búsqueda se utiliza para obtener el nombre de dominio relacionado con una dirección IP. Los servidores de correo electrónico suelen utilizar búsquedas inversas para asegurarse de que los servidores de los que reciben mensajes son válidos.

Para completar este proceso, el servidor de correo debe tener establecido un registro PTR (de puntero). Este tipo de registro informa a otros servidores de correo de que su dirección IP es autoritativa para enviar y recibir correo para el dominio relacionado.

El propietario de la IP (normalmente, el proveedor de servicios de Internet [ISP] o el proveedor de alojamiento del servidor de correo electrónico) delega una zona para el servidor que acaba en «in-addr.arpa», con números que preceden a las letras. Los números son el bloque IP del servidor con los octetos invertidos.

Comandos de la búsqueda de DNS

La información de DNS sobre un dominio se puede obtener utilizando comandos de búsqueda de DNS. Estos comandos proporcionan varios datos, como los servidores de nombres, los servidores de correo y los registros configurados.

Nslookup

Una búsqueda de servidor de nombres, también conocida como «nslookup», permite localizar el servidor de nombres asociado a un dominio junto con cualquier registro configurado. Esta información se puede resolver utilizando una dirección IP o un nombre de dominio como opción de búsqueda.

El comando para un nslookup difiere ligeramente entre PC, Mac y Linux. En Windows 10, el comando se ejecuta a través del símbolo del sistema. En Mac, el comando se ejecuta a través de Terminal. Los usuarios de Linux utilizan dig, que también es una utilidad de línea de comandos que permite localizar información sobre los dominios.